Ingredients for Mediterranean Chicken Zucchini Bake

For the Chicken & Vegetables:

  • 2 large chicken breasts, cut into chunks
  • 2 zucchinis, sliced into rounds
  • 1 red b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 yellow bell pepper, sliced
  • ½ red onion, sliced
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• ¼ cup Kalamata olives, sliced
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• ½ teaspoon dried basil
  • ½ teaspoon paprika
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per

For Garnish:

  • ¼ cup crumbled feta cheese
  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
  • Lemon wedges for serving

Step-by-Step Instructions to Make Mediterranean Chicken Zucchini Bake

Step 1: Preheat & Prepare the Baking Dish

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Lightly grease a 9×13-inch baking dish with olive oil or nonstick spray.

Step 2: Prepare the Chicken & Vegetables

  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ine chicken, zucchini, bell peppers, red onion, cherry tomatoes, garlic, and olives.
  2. Drizzle with olive oil, then sprinkle with oregano, basil,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Toss well to coat evenly.

Step 3: Assemble & Bake

  1. Spread everything evenly in the baking dish.
  2.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the chicken is fully cooked (internal temperature 165°F/75°C).
  3. Remove from oven and let rest for 5 minutes.

Step 4: Garnish & Serve

  1. Sprinkle with crumbled feta cheese and fresh parsley.
  2. Serve with lemon wedges for extra flavor.

Expert Tips for the Best Mediterranean Chicken Zucchini Bake

  • Cut ingredients evenly – Ensures even cooking.
  • Use high heat – Helps caramelize the veggies for extra flavor.
  • Don’t overbake the chicken – Keeps it juicy and tender.
  • Add chickpeas – For extra protein and fiber.
  • Make it dairy-free – Omit the feta or use a plant-based alternative.

Fun Variations of Mediterranean Chicken Zucchini Bake

  • Spicy Mediterranean Bake – Add red pepper flakes for heat.
  • Lemon Garlic Chicken Bake – Marinate chicken in lemon juice & garlic before baking.
  • Roasted Eggplant Addition – Add cubed eggplant for more texture.
  • Greek Chicken & Potatoes – Toss in baby potatoes for a heartier meal.

How to Store & Keep Your Chicken Zucchini Bake Fresh

  • Refrigerate: Store in an airtight container for up to 4 days.
  • Freeze: Freeze individual portions for up to 2 months.
  • Reheat: Warm in the oven at 350°F (175°C) for 10-15 minutes or microwave for 2 minutes.

FAQ Section

1. Can I use chicken thighs instead of chicken breasts?
Yes! Boneless, skinless chicken thighs will add extra juiciness and flavor.

2. How can I make this recipe vegetarian?
Swap the chicken for chickpeas, tofu, or halloumi cheese for a vegetarian version.

3. Can I make this dish ahead of time?
Yes! Chop and season everything, then store in the fridge overnight before baking.
